Meta-analysis of risk factors for ventilator-associated pneumonia in intensive care units of neurosurgery |

Abstract Objective To systematic evaluate the risk factors for ventilator-associated pneumonia (VAP) in neurosurgery ICU. Methods Relevant literatures in CNKI, VIP, Wanfang, PubMed, Embase, The Cochrane library, CBM, Web of Science and other Chinese and English databases were searched by computer until June 2024. Meta-analysis was performed using RevMan5.4 and stata15.0. Results A total of 11 literatures were included, including 9 Chinese ones and 2 English ones, 2022 subjects were included in the study, and 16 possible risk factors were comprehensively evaluated. Smoking, coma, APACHE Ⅱ score, serum albumin <30 g/L, antibiotic use time >3 d, glucocorticoid use, sedative use, hypothermia treatment, mechanical ventilation time≥5 d, and long ICU stay were the risk factors for VAP in neurosurgery ICU (P<0.05). Early use of antibiotics could reduce the occurrence of VAP (P<0.05). Conclusions In order to identify and take effective prevention and control measures in the early stage to reduce the occurrence of VAP in neurosurgery ICU, clinical staff should closely monitor the above mentioned risk factors.
